Investing in ELSS mutual funds gives us a tax exemption of up to Rs 1.5 lakh under section 80C. You can invest money in ELSS funds in lump sum or through SIP. Here are the top 6 ELSS Mutual Funds that outperform Fixed Deposits (FDs) and deliver returns of up to 21, as per data available on the Association of Mutual Funds in India (AMFI) website till March 3, 2023. First on the list is the Tax Plan. The 5-year average profitability of the direct scheme of the tax plan was 21.73 percent. Similarly, the fixed plan has returned up to 19.89 percent in five years. The tax plan tracks the Nifty 500 total income index.

The direct plan of Mirae Asset Tax Saver Fund has returned 15.02 percent over five years and the fixed plan has returned 13.44 percent to investors. This ELSS Mutual Fund also tracks the Nifty 500 Total Return Index.

The third fund in the list is Canara Robeco Equity Tax Saver Fund. This fund has also given excellent returns to investors in the last 5 years. Investors got 15.38 percent return for 5 years from its direct plan while fixed plan gave investors 14.13 percent return.

At number four on the list, Kotak Tax Savings Fund has generated huge returns for investors over the past five years. Those who invested in the direct plan of this mutual fund got 14.31 percent return. And the next plan of the “Kotak” tax saving fund gave 12.88 percent income in five years.

PGIM India ELSS Tax Saver Fund is also included in ELSS Mutual Funds which provide amazing returns. The direct plan of this fund has given investors a return of 13.59 per cent in five years, while the regular plan has given a return of 11.92 per cent.

The last ELSS fund in this list is Bank of India Tax Benefit Fund. The five-year average return of the Bank of India’s Tax Benefit Fund Direct Plan was 13.32 percent. Similarly, its fixed plan has given investors a return of 12.32 percent over five years.
